# Running cmake in a tree in which we have run ./configure ; make
# creates include/exiv2/exv_conf.h which conflicts with cmake's own exv_conf.h
# This causes incorrect compilation and linking errors.
#
# It's OK to delete this as it will be recreated on demand by <exiv2-dir>/Makefile
if( EXISTS "${CMAKE_SOURCE_DIR}/include/exiv2/exv_conf.h"  )
    file(REMOVE "${CMAKE_SOURCE_DIR}/include/exiv2/exv_conf.h")
endif()

# options and their default values
OPTION( EXIV2_ENABLE_SHARED        "Build exiv2 as a shared library (dll)"                 ON  )
OPTION( EXIV2_ENABLE_XMP           "Build with XMP metadata support"                       ON  )
OPTION( EXIV2_ENABLE_LIBXMP        "Build a static convenience Library for XMP"            ON  )
OPTION( EXIV2_ENABLE_PNG           "Build with png support (requires libz)"                ON  )
OPTION( EXIV2_ENABLE_NLS           "Build native language support (requires gettext)"      ON  )
OPTION( EXIV2_ENABLE_PRINTUCS2     "Build with Printucs2"                                  ON  )
OPTION( EXIV2_ENABLE_LENSDATA      "Build including lens data"                             ON  )
OPTION( EXIV2_ENABLE_COMMERCIAL    "Build with the EXV_COMMERCIAL_VERSION symbol set"      OFF )
OPTION( EXIV2_ENABLE_BUILD_SAMPLES "Build the unit tests"                                  ON  )
OPTION( EXIV2_ENABLE_BUILD_PO      "Build translations files"                              OFF )
OPTION( EXIV2_ENABLE_VIDEO         "Build video support into library"                      OFF )
OPTION( EXIV2_ENABLE_WEBREADY      "Build webready support into library"                   OFF )
IF (WIN32)
    OPTION( EXIV2_ENABLE_DYNAMIC_RUNTIME  "Use dynamic runtime (used for static libs)"     OFF )
    OPTION( EXIV2_ENABLE_WIN_UNICODE   "Use Unicode paths (wstring) on Windows"            OFF )
    OPTION( EXIV2_ENABLE_CURL          "USE Libcurl for HttpIo"                            OFF )
    OPTION( EXIV2_ENABLE_SSH           "USE Libssh for SshIo"                              OFF )
ELSE()
    OPTION( EXIV2_ENABLE_CURL          "USE Libcurl for HttpIo"                            ON  )
    OPTION( EXIV2_ENABLE_SSH           "USE Libssh for SshIo"                              ON  )
    SET ( EXIV2_ENABLE_DYNAMIC_RUNTIME OFF )
ENDIF()
